Updated.

Canadian:
-Blue Circle Audio
-Mapletree Audio
-McAlister Audio
-Practical Devices
-Space-Tech Labs

Chinese/Taiwanese/Hong Kong:
- Cayin
- Citypulse (?)
- Darkvoice (?)
- Firestone Audio
- Headb C&C
- iBasso
- Little Tube
- Shanling
- Travagan

Holland:
- iQube

Hungary:
- Heed

Italian:
- Casea
- Rudistor

Japanese:
- Accuphase
- Onkyo
- Stax
- TakeT
- Yamamoto Soundcraft
- Yoshino

Russia:
- Laconic Lunchbox (EddieCurrent in U.S.A)

Sweden:
- Harmony Design

United Kingdom:
- Graham Slee

U.S.A:
- LISA
- Singlepower
- Woo Audio
- Xin
